Jeb Bush made headlines after the televised CNN’s Republican party debate, when Bush demanded an apology from Trump regarding remarks he made about his wife, who was born in Mexico. Trump was correct, Bush made the same point in his own book.

The first two sentences of Jeb Bush’s 2013 book, “Immigration Wars,” Bush admitted that his wife Columba had in fact shaped his views on immigration. “Immigration to me is personal. It means my wife and my family.”  Trump and Bush agree that Columba Bush influenced Jeb’s immigration views.

Since presidential candidates wives are now in the public spotlight, what’s Melania Trump’s views on immigration?

Trump told CNN

“She went through a long process to become a citizen. It was very tough,” adding that Melania agrees with his immigration position. “When she got it, she was very proud of it. She came from Europe, and she was very, very proud of it. And she thinks it’s a beautiful process when it works.”

Mary Jordan reported in the Washington Post that Donald Trump’s wife Melania shies away from many public speaking engagements but will now find herself more in the spotlight.

Melania would become a new model as a first lady. Born in Slovenia, Melania was a former high fashion model, started her own jewelry line, and speaks four languages.

As reported by Mary Jordan,  “She provides great balance” to Trump, said Roger Stone, Trump’s former political adviser. She is smart “not just an arm-piece,” Stone said. “She would be the most glamorous first lady since Jackie Kennedy.”

Friends said Melania doesn’t accompany Donald on many of his cross country campaign tours since she prefers to stay at home with the couple’s 9-year-old son, Barron.
